FAQs - booking Europe flights

  • Which airlines offer unaccompanied minor services on flights from Tampa to Europe?

    Consider booking with Lufthansa, which allows kids ages 5 to 11 to travel alone on flights from Tampa to Europe. The child must be accompanied to TPA for check-in and have the unaccompanied minor form throughout the journey. Ensure you have your identification documents as you accompany your child to the airport, the child’s birth certificate, and the contact and identification details of the person to pick the child up at the destination airport.

  • What are the common layover cities for flights from Tampa to Europe?

    Various airlines flying from Tampa to Europe have layovers. Most airlines with layovers along the Tampa-Europe routes have them in their airport hubs. The common layover cities for flights from Tampa to Europe include Atlanta (ATL) and New York (JFK) by Delta Air Lines, Miami (MIA) and Charlotte Douglas (CLT) by American Airlines, Amsterdam (AMS) by KLM Royal Dutch Airlines, and London Heathrow (LHR) by British Airways.

  • What accessibility services does Tampa International Airport offer to passengers with special needs traveling on flights from Tampa to Europe?

    TPA has accessible restrooms and parking spaces for passengers with limited mobility. TPA considers passengers with hearing impairments by providing TDD phones in various locations of the airport and visual and auditory aids for passengers with visual impairments. Tampa Airport allows service animals access to the airport and has relief areas for service animals.

  • Do I need a visa to travel to Europe from Tampa?

    US citizens do not need a visa to fly to Europe from Tampa for short tourism and business visits of up to 90 days within 180 days in the Schengen area. However, ensure you have a visa if you visit a non-Schengen country from Tampa. You must have a valid passport before you board a flight from Tampa to Europe. The passport must be valid for at least six months beyond the intended departure date.

Top tips for finding cheap flights to Europe

  • Looking for a cheap flight? 25% of our users found tickets from Tampa to the following destinations at these prices or less: Frankfurt am Main $812 one-way - $1,109 round-trip; London $528 one-way - $783 round-trip
  • Morning departure is around 9% cheaper than an evening flight, on average*.
  • Tampa International Airport (TPA) is the primary airport serving the Tampa Bay area. The airport is a hub for Silver Airways and an operating base for Breeze Airways, Frontier Airlines, and Southwest Airlines, offering frequent flights from Tampa to Europe.
  • London Gatwick and London Heathrow are the busiest international routes in Europe from Tampa. London Heathrow Airport (LHR) has excellent connectivity to various destinations within Europe. The Tampa-London Gatwick Airport (LGW) route has many low-cost airlines and is a budget-friendly option for visiting London from Tampa.
  • Amsterdam Schiphol Airport (AMS) has a well-developed train system offering transit to various international destinations, including Belgium, Germany, and France. High-speed trains from AMS connect to cities including Paris, Brussels, Frankfurt, and Berlin. With a single layover, you can fly from Tampa to AMS by KLM, Delta Air Lines, British Airways, and Air France, making it an efficient gateway for flights from Tampa to Europe.
  • When booking a flight from Tampa to Europe with baggage, consider flying Lufthansa, which allows economy passengers to bring carry-on baggage weighing at most 17 lb with maximum dimensions of 21.5 x 15.5 x 9 inches. The airline also allows you to bring an extra personal item for free in the cabin if it fits in the seat in front of you.
  • Tampa Airport has two lounges, the Delta Sky Club in Concourse E and the American Airlines Admirals Club in Concourse F, accessible to certain passengers on flights from Tampa to Europe. At these lounges, you can enjoy comfortable seating, complimentary refreshments, and business services. Fees may apply for entrance to these clubs.
